For all of those on the list interested who have never heard of the show...
it is everyone and anyone involved in outdoor industry....all of the
Jansports, Eurekas, Keltys, etc. as well as the buyers for everyone from
BSA Supply Division, Wal-Mart, Campmor, etc. even SCOUTER Magazine's humble
little 1-800-SCOUTER Catalog division (okay with "Big Ed" perhaps not sooo
little after all :-). There are over 800 booths this year as well as a
tent city outside.

UNFORTUNATELY....<<I know I'll be asked so I will say it here>> it is NOT
open to the public (if so I suspect every Scout Leader in America would try
and get a pass). Every year as I walk the isles I keep asking myself how
many of these people who represent the outdoor industry had their first
camping experience, or first outdoor meal with a Scout Troop. I am sure
many of the manufacturer reps backpacking shop proprietors, manufacturers,
etc. would raise their hand and recall many warm memories of their Scouting
days.
